Overview

The TB67S580FNG is a bipolar stepping motor driver IC that utilizes a DMOS output stage to deliver up to 1.6A. It supports high-voltage operation up to 44V and features a simple clock-input interface for ease of control without complex SPI programming.

Why Choose This Part

This driver integrates Mixed, Slow, and Fast decay modes to optimize torque and reduce vibration across different speeds. It minimizes external component count by reducing charge pump requirements and provides a 3.3V regulator output to power low-voltage logic or sensors.

Getting Started

To evaluate this IC, monitor the nFAULT pin for error conditions like over-current or thermal shutdown. Ensure the HTSSOP package's thermal pad is soldered to a large copper plane on the PCB to manage heat dissipation during 1.6A operation.
